Posted by Martin Iturbide - Tuesday, 06 May 2008
The FAT32 driver has been updated to 0.9.12 fix 1 and can be downloaded from Netlabs. ftp://www.ftp.netlabs.org/pub/fat32/ fat32_09121.zip fat32_09121.wpi This version fixes the problem that a program trying to READ/WRITE from/to memory object with OBJ_ANY attribute crashes. The WPI version does install Lazywrite. If writing to removable drives is slow, either rem the CACHEF32 statement in the config.sys or add the following option to the CACHEF32 statement: /L:OFF Set lazy writing OFF From: David Graser Source: OS2VOICE.org (13) Comments |
